Transaction 58842b4b6d8023d5205998333c0f45c4a3c6a4a2fd0f0d07435431659b252467
1 Input
1 Output
-
58842b4b6d8023d5205998333c0f45c4a3c6a4a2fd0f0d07435431659b252467:0
- value
- 560796
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c08417c6372b260d1eace6b5c9e1de67efa236bd OP_EQUAL
- address
- 3KEwuMAtPq5QgQMRtSrTvjVrTanoVNBNFU